/**!
 * 某某页面-首页
 * author: gaoli;
 * date:2017-09-12
 */

.ewb-bord {
    float: left;
    width: 240px;
    margin-top: 8px;
    margin-left: 10px;
}
.ewb-bord-hd {
    height: 25px;
    line-height: 25px;
    text-align: center;
    background: url(imagesbord_bg.jpg) no-repeat;
}
.ewb-bord-tt {
    font-size: 14px;
    color: #fff;
    font-weight: bold;
}
.ewb-bord-bd {
    height: 235px;
    border: 1px solid #c6c6c6;
    background: url(imagesbord_img.jpg) repeat-x;
}
.wb-tab-infor {
    width: 220px;
}
.wb-textlist {
    width: 230px;
    overflow: hidden;
}

.wb-textlist li {
    padding-left: 20px;
    line-height: 28px;
    height: 28px;
    font-size: 13px;
    background: url(imageslistimg.jpg) no-repeat 12px center;
}
.wb-data {
    float: right;
    padding-right: 15px;
    margin-top: -28px;
}
.wb-textlist a {
    display: block;
    color: #333;
    width:70%;
     overflow: hidden;
    white-space: nowrap;
    text-overflow: ellipsis;
}

/* 图片轮播 */

.ewb-slide {
    float: left;
    width: 346px;
    height: 262px;
    margin-top: 8px;
    margin-left: 20px;
    overflow: hidden;

}
.wb-slider {
    position: relative;
    overflow: hidden;
    z-index:1;
}
.wb-slider-conbox {
    overflow: hidden;
}
.wb-slider-ctag {
    position: relative;
}
.wb-slider-ctag img {
    height: 100%;
    width: 100%;
}
.wb-slider-mask {
    position: absolute;
    bottom: 0;
    left: 0;
    width: 100%;
    height: 30px;
    line-height: 30px;
    font-size: 12px;
    font-family: "宋体";
    color: #333;
    font-weight: bold;
    background-color: #ccc;
    text-align: center;
}
.wb-slider-mask.ellipsis {
    color: #fff;
    white-space: nowrap;
    text-overflow: ellipsis;
    overflow: hidden;
    text-decoration: none;
}
.wb-slider-mask a {
    color: #000;
}
.wb-slider-mask a:hover {
    color: #ff0000;
}
.wb-slider-switcher {
    position: absolute;
    right: 0;
    bottom: 24px;
    height: 18px;
}
.wb-slider-stag {
    float: left;
    margin-right: 1px;
    height: 12px;
    width: 23px;
    border-left: 1px solid #fff;
    border-right: 1px solid #fff;
    line-height: 12px;
    text-align: center;
    color: #fff;
    background: url(imagesmask_bg.png) repeat;
    cursor: pointer;
    font-size: 12px;
    font-family: "宋体";
}
.wb-slider-stag.cur {
    background: #ce0609;
    border-color: #fff;
}

/* 工作广角 */

.ewb-work {
    float: left;
    width: 346px;
    margin-top: 8px;
    margin-left: 20px;
}
.ewb-work-hd {
    height: 29px;
    line-height: 29px;
    background: url(images1_r8_c4.jpg) no-repeat;
}
.ewb-work-tt {
    float: left;
    font-size: 14px;
    color: #5d0000;
    margin-left: 20px;
    cursor: pointer;
}
.ewb-work-more {
    float: right;
    color: #333;
    margin-right: 10px;
    cursor: pointer;
}
.ewb-work-bd {
    height: 232px;
    border: 1px solid #969696;
    border-top:none;
}
.tab-item {
    float: left;
    width: 114px;
    height: 25px;
    line-height: 25px;
    color: #333;
    cursor: pointer;
    text-align: center;
    background: url(imagesbmcz1_02.jpg) repeat-x;
    border: 1px solid #979797;
    border-top: none;
    border-right: none;
}
.tab-item:first-child {
    border-left: none;
}
.tab-item.active {
    background: #fff;
    border-bottom: none;
    color: #d80700;
    font-weight: bold;
}


/* 政务公开 */

.ewb-open {
    width: 240px;
    float: left;
    margin: 8px 0 0 10px;
}
.ewb-bord-hd.open {
    text-align: left;
    text-indent: 20px;
}
.ewb-open-bd {
    height: 63px;
    border: 1px solid #c6c6c6;
    background-color: #ebebeb;
    padding: 10px 0 0 10px;
}
.ewb-open-item {
    float: left;
    width: 112px;
    height: 29px;
}
.ewb-open-item.fir {
    background: url(images090617162126021.jpg) no-repeat;
}
.ewb-open-item.sec {
    background: url(images090617162126021.jpg) no-repeat;
}
.ewb-open-item.thi {
    background: url(images090617162126021.jpg) no-repeat;
}
.ewb-open-item.for {
    background: url(images090617162126021.jpg) no-repeat;
}
.ewb-open-item a {
    width:112px;
    height: 29px;
    display: block;
    cursor: pointer;
    padding: 6px 0 0 35px;
    color:#333;
}
.ewb-work-img {
    display: block;
    margin-top: 8px;
    cursor: pointer;
}
.ewb-work-img img {
    vertical-align: top;
}

/* 政策文件 */

.ewb-work-tt {
    color: #5d0000;
    cursor: pointer;
}
.ewb-work-bd.file {
    height: 172px;
}
.wb-data-list.file {
    line-height: 22px;
}
.wb-data-list.file .wb-data-date {
    margin-top: -22px;
}
.ewb-hotnew:hover,
.ewb-hotnew-link:hover {
    color: #d80700 !important;
    cursor: pointer !important;
}

/* flash */

.ewb-flash02 embed {
    margin-top: 10px;
    margin-left: 10px;
}

/* left */


/* banner */

.ewb-left {
    width: 241px;
    float: left;
    margin-left: 10px;
}
.ewb-banner-link {
    display: block;
    cursor: pointer;
    margin-top: 4px;
}
.ewb-left-banner img {
    vertical-align: top;
}

/* 服务导航 */

.ewb-left-service {
    width: 240px;
    height: 114px;
    margin-top: 4px;
    background: url(imagesleft_r2_c1.jpg) no-repeat;
}
.ewb-service-item a {
    color: #333;
    cursor: pointer;
}
.ewb-service-item {
    float: left;
    margin-left: 5px;
    padding-left: 10px;
    background: url(imageslistimg.jpg) no-repeat 5px center;
}
.ewb-service-items {
    padding: 45px 0 0 10px;
}

/* 友情链接 */
.ewb-left-friend{
	height: 310px;
	background-color: #f4f4f4;
}
.ewb-fri{
    width: 240px;
/*    height: 257px;*/
    padding: 50px 0 0 0px;
    background: url(imagesleft_r3_c1.jpg) no-repeat;
}
.ewb-fri-img {
    float: left;
    cursor: pointer;
    margin-top:4px;
    margin-left: 9px;
}
.ewb-fri-img img {
    width: 106px;
    height: 38px;
    vertical-align: top;

}
.ewb-fri-old{
	width:200px;
	height: 19px;
	margin:15px 0 0 18px;
}
.ewb-fri-gov{
	width:150px;
	height: 19px;
	margin:15px 0 0 40px;
}


/* right */
.ewb-right{
	width:730px;
	float:right;
}
.ewb-menu-link{
 float: left;
 cursor: pointer;
}

/* 生活向导 */
.ewb-work.spec{
  margin:7px;
  width:350px;
}
.ewb-work-hd.spec{
	height: 29px;
	width:350px;
	background:url(images1_r12_c3.jpg) no-repeat;
}
.ewb-work-bd.spec .tab-item{
	width:115px;
}
/* gif */
.ewb-last{
	display: block;
	margin:0 0 0 10px;
}
.ewb-last img{
    margin-top:10px;
	vertical-align: top;
	width:970px;
}
/* 浮动广告 */
.float-img {
    z-index: 1000;
    width: 100%;
    height:100%;
    position: fixed;
    left: 0;
    top: 0;
}

.float-img img {
    width: 300px;
    height: 90px;
}

.close {
    display: block;
    position: absolute;
    width: 40px;
    height: 20px;
    top: 90px;
   left: 268px;
}

.wb-slider2{
    position: relative;
    width:300px;
    height: 90px;
}
.wb-slider-switcher.spec{
    left: 192px;
    top:70px;
}
